.navbar-light .navbar-brand, .navbar-light .navbar-brand:focus, .navbar-light .navbar-brand:hover {
  background-image:url("../../assets/img/logo-nav-bar.png");
  width:95px;
  height:80px;
  background-repeat:no-repeat;
}

.clean-block clean-hero {
  background-image:url("../../assets/img/banner-1-01.png");
}

.btn:not(:disabled):not(.disabled) {
}

#bannerimprentat {
  color:#fff;
}

#bannerimprentat {
}

#tituloimprenta {
  margin-top:0px;
}

.img-thumbnail {
  background-color:transparent;
  border:none;
}

#titulomateriales {
  background-color:#e41987;
  color:rgb(255,255,255);
  padding:18px;
  padding-right:0px;
  padding-bottom:0px;
  padding-left:0px;
}

#tituloImprenta {
  background-color:#009ddf;
  color:rgb(255,255,255);
  padding:18px;
  padding-right:0px;
  padding-bottom:0px;
  padding-left:0px;
}

#hightlight-note {
  width:350px;
  font-size:1.5em;
  padding-top:20px;
}

.paragraphBanner {
  text-align:center;
}

.quienes.somos {
  text-align:justify;
  padding-left:10px;
  padding-right:10px;
}

@media (min-width: 300px) {
  .quienes.somos {
    text-align:justify;
    padding-left:100px;
    padding-right:100px;
  }
}

#image_mini_header {
  width:100%;
  height:auto;
  margin-top:50px;
}

#botones {
  text-align:center;
}

#diseno {
  margin-top:0px;
}

img, svg:not(:root) {
}

img, svg:not(:root) {
  margin-left:auto;
  margin-right:auto;
}

div {
}

#ilustracion {
  text-align:center;
}

img, svg:not(:root) {
}

.imagenheader {
  width:100%;
}

.col.seccion_diseno {
  padding-left:50px;
  padding-right:50px;
  visibility:hidden;
}

@media (min-width: 768px) {
  .col.seccion_diseno {
    padding-left:100px;
    padding-right:100px;
    visibility:visible;
  }
}

@media (min-width: 992px) {
  .col.seccion_diseno {
    padding-left:100px;
    padding-right:100px;
    visibility:visible;
  }
}

#titulo_diseno {
  text-align:center;
  color:rgb(255,255,255);
  background-color:rgb(12,12,33);
  margin-top:100px;
}

.col.diseno {
  margin-left:150px;
}

